2015 BASIS Training Kicks Off This Week For 40 New Business Agents

(WASHINGTON) – Forty new Teamsters Business Agents from across the country have travelled to Washington D.C. to participate in this week’s Business Agent Skills in Survival (BASIS) training.

The five-day program at the IBT Headquarters provides an overview of the skills and knowledge needed to be successful as a Teamsters Business Agent. The subjects include: bargaining, grievance handling, building solidarity within bargaining units, organizing work and developing strong steward systems.

The Business Agents will attend workshops run by IBT and affiliate staff members who will share their expertise and experience with the goal of providing the attendees a foundation that will help them better serve the members for which they represent.

BASIS is just one of the courses offered annually to officers of the union by the Teamsters Leadership Academy. Additional information on the courses offered by the IBT Training and Development Department can be found here.
